The CMF Phone 1: Mid-Tier Innovation with the Exclusive Nothing Lock Feature

Anticipated Gadget with a Custom Twist: The tech community is buzzing with anticipation as details emerge about the upcoming CMF Phone 1. Slated for a July 2024 release, this mid-tier smartphone is making waves with its innovative feature known as the Nothing Lock. The Nothing Lock is not just any feature; it is a unique connection on the back of the device designed specifically to attach exclusive Nothing accessories like lanyards and grips.

Securing these premium accessories will require a bit of hands-on work. Users will need to use a screwdriver to undo a screw to attach the special feature. This novel approach marries customization with a touch of do-it-yourself spirit, adding to the allure of the smartphone.

CMF Phone 1’s pricing strikes a balance between affordability and the provision of a distinct experience. With an estimated cost ranging from $249 to $279, tech enthusiasts can get their hands on a phone that doesn’t break the bank yet stands out for its peculiarity.
